The oldest senior class society at … WebMar 5, 2024 · When osteosarcoma affects the flat bones such as those in the skull, affected dogs typically present localized swelling. Osteosarcomas tend to grow fast and spread rapidly to other organs, in particular to the lungs. X-rays of the lungs should be done to check for signs of the cancer spreading. WebAug 1, 2024 · The cranial roof consists of the frontal, occipital, and two parietal bones. The cranial base is composed of the frontal, sphenoid, ethmoid, occipital, parietal, and temporal bones. As you can see, the cranial roof and cranial base are not mutually exclusive as they share some of the same bones. WebJul 4, 2024 · The bones of the skull are formed in two different ways; intramembranous ossification and endochondral ossification are responsible for creating compact cortical bone or spongy bone. During the maturation of the skull, it is categorically divided into two main parts: the viscerocranium and the neurocranium.

WebThe bones that form the top and sides of the brain case are usually referred to as the “flat” bones of the skull. The floor of the brain case is referred to as the base of the skull. This is a complex area that varies in depth and has numerous openings for the passage of cranial nerves, blood vessels, and the spinal cord.
